The red wooden panels on each side of my Electro 3 had been damaged. I received new ones.
I expected that it would only be a matter of unscrewing the 3 screws of the existing side panels,
but they appeared to be also attached to the metal top panel.
So I unscrewed the screws of the top at the back of the Electro 3, but the top is still attached to something else.
How do I proceed ?

Just wanted to say that the process of unscrewing side panels on the HP3 is straightforward, it is fixed only by screws on the panels.
I had to open mine as I had a bit of noise the source of which I’ve fortunately correctly guessed.
The flat cable from keybed was approximately 0.5mm away from something else and it apparently vibrated during playing and producing unpleasant sound. With the long stick I just moved it a little bit and since then no problems. I should have taken the picture to show, sorry
